Product Introduction

Overview

The AD5542CRZ, produced by Analog Devices Inc., is a single, 16-bit, serial input, voltage output digital-to-analog converter (DAC) designed to operate from a single supply voltage ranging from 2.7 V to 5.5 V. This device is part of the AD5541/AD5542 family, known for its low power consumption, high accuracy, and versatile interface compatibility. The AD5542CRZ is available in a 14-lead SOIC package and is suitable for various applications requiring precise digital-to-analog conversion.

Key Specifications

Parameter Value Unit Test Conditions
Supply Voltage (VDD) 2.7 to 5.5 V
Power Dissipation 0.625 to 0.825 mW Digital inputs at rails
Settling Time 1 μs
Integral Nonlinearity (INL) 1 LSB Over full temperature range
Noise Performance 11.8 nV/√Hz
Glitch 1.1 nV-sec
Interface Compatibility SPI, QSPI, MICROWIRE, DSP
Package 14-lead SOIC
Operating Temperature Range −40°C to +85°C

Key Features

  • Single 16-bit DAC with serial input and voltage output
  • Operates from a single 2.7 V to 5.5 V supply
  • Low power dissipation: 0.625 mW to 0.825 mW
  • Fast settling time: 1 μs
  • Unbuffered voltage output capable of driving 60 kΩ loads directly
  • Compatible with SPI, QSPI, MICROWIRE, and DSP interface standards
  • Power-on reset to 0 V in unipolar mode and to −VREF in bipolar mode
  • Kelvin sense connections for reference and analog ground pins to reduce layout sensitivity
  • Low noise performance and low glitch

Applications

  • Digital gain and offset adjustment
  • Automatic test equipment
  • Data acquisition systems
  • Industrial process control
